The game begins with Prince Rhys standing in the center of
Landen Town. Today he is supposed to marry Maia, a woman with a mysterious
past. Enter
Landen Castle and speak
with Maia to begin the wedding.
In the
middle of the wedding a dragon flies in and proclaims "
Filthy
Orakians! Maia will not be yours!" then kidnaps Maia. Rhys tries
to take the army to search for her but the King tells him to "
Cool
off in the dungeon for a while!". A pair of soldiers grab Rhys
and toss him in the
dungeon. Luckily, the jail cell
has three
treasure chests containing a monitor, 200 meseta, and a knife.
After
opening the three treasure chests a young woman named Lena will sneak into
the
dungeon and free Rhys. Rhys will now be back in
Landen town, use the
money from the
dungeon to buy armor and save the game in the inn. Talk to
people in
Landen town to learn that "
A monster stole the Sapphire
and flew south, toward the island. Some say it was a man...."
Going south to will first lead to
Yaata
Town.
In
Yaata town there is an old man who owns a boat. However,
he won't sail to the island without a Cyborg on board. One of the
townspeople tells Rhys "
Walk across the bridge to reach Ilan."
Leave
Yaata and head to
Ilan to continue.
The townspeople of
Ilan have much information. One person
"
saw a dragon carry a woman toward the east. They entered a cave
and never came out." and another "
saw one of Laya's
people at a lake by the northeastern forest. The woman never blinked!".
The
eastern cave is sealed and Rhys can not enter. Go to the northeastern
forest, the woman standing there is Mieu. Talk to her and she will join
the group. Return to
Yaata
town, the old man will now take Rhys to the
island cave.
While sailing to the
cavethe old man shows Rhys a "
palacedown
there in the muck? Our oldest legend says the evil Dark Force is trapped
there by the sword of Orakio!" This
palacewill be very important
later in the game. Once arriving on the island enter the
cave. All the way
in the back of the
caveis a man named Lyle. He will give Rhys the sapphire.
Exit the
caveonce Rhys has the sapphire and sail back.
With the sapphire in hand, Rhys can now enter the
eastern cave in hopes of
finding Maia. The cave is actually a
passage to the world of Aquatica.
Something is very wrong in Aquatica though, the land is completely frozen.
The only town in sight is the
village of Rysel.
Speaking to the townspeople of
Rysel reveals two important clues, "
Some
people across the sea worship Laya" and "
Orakio's
fortresses once stood south of here. Legends mention a hidden gate near
their ruins". Since the sea can not be crossed the only
option is to go south and
enter the
passage.
Traveling through the
passage leads to the desert world of Aridia. The
only town is
Hazatak which can be found at the top of the small river to
the south. Use the monitor to guide Rhys and Mieu to the
town of Hazatak.
In
Hazatak Rhys will learn of a
weather control system to the east, and
cyborg who can repair it to the west. Rhys will also learn of "
an
old, crazy cyborg" wandering the desert. This cyborg is Miun, she
can not help Rhys but will be needed later in the game. Head west to find
the cyborg to repair the
weather
system.
In the
western cave Rhys finds Wren a
technical systems and combat
specialist. Wren can use some of the most powerful weapons in the
game. Take Wren east to the
weather control
system.
Standing at the entrance to the weather control system is Lyle. He has the
gem needed to repair the weather control system and will join the group. The
weather control system is located on the
first floor of the tower. Once Wren has restored
the weather system leave the tower and return to the world of Aquatica.
One of the townspeople of
Rysel is so
grateful to Rhys for restoring the
weather that he will allow Rhys to take his boat east. Sail east to arrive
on an island that is home to the
Orakian town of Agoe and the
Layan town
of Shusoran.
Agoe is to the east and
Shusoran is to the north.
Agoe is warring with the neighboring town of
Shusoran. Rhys learns from a
villager that "
Laya's people have an army of vile monsters. We
must fight them with cyborgs and machines, just as Orakio did 1,000 years
ago." Rhys also hears "
A young woman was taken into
Shusoran's castle " and "
Stories tell of monsters
appearing in fountains-- especially the fountains of Shusoran!".
Leave
Agoe and proceed north to
Shusoran town.
The
town of Shusoran is not very friendly to Rhys.
Just be thankful
you're with Prince Lylebecause the guards in the city will not attack
Rhys. Walk into a fountain to enter
Shusoran dungeon which leads into
Shusoran castle.
While traveling through
Shusoran castle Lyle will leave the group without explanation.
In the throne room of the
castle Lyle is standing in front of Lena. He
challenges Rhys to a one-on-one fight.
Since only Rhys can fight in this battle make sure he has a stash of
dimate in his possession before the fight begins. Regardless of how
powerful Lyle is in the game, in this fight he is not especially strong.
His attacks will typically do 8-15 hit points of damage, and should be
defeated in three or four rounds.
After the fight Lyle rejoins the group. Talk the
Lena and she says "
Return to Aridia and put my Moon Stone and
Lyle's Moon Tear into the satellite control
system. That will bring the
moon back to its proper place and open a land bridge from the rear gate of
this castle to where Maia is being held" then joins the group.
Leave
Shusoran castle and travel back to Aridia to the
weather/satellite
control tower.
The satellite control system is located on the
second floor of the tower.
Once Wren fixes the system the land bridge back on Aquatica will reform.
Travel all the way back to
Shusoran castle and take the northern exit
leading to
Cille.
Cille is also a Layan land, and the people don't care much for Rhys. Once
again, the presence of Prince Lyle prevents then from attacking the party.
Walk into the third fountain from the left to enter
Cille's
dungeon, which
will lead to the
castle. Inside the
castle Rhys finds the King of Cille
guarding Maia.
The King of Cille is guarded by six dryads. He also possesses the zan
technique which can do serious damage to the party. Wren is the only one
who can attack the King of Cille until the dryads are slain. The dryads
should be killed off in two rounds. Once they are gone every character should
attack the King of Cille except for using Mieu or Lyle to cast gires whenever
the group is hurt. Since Mieu has a more powerful attack use Lyle unless the
party is hurt badly and needs both to heal. Although the King has a strong attack he should be
defeated in only a couple rounds. He apparently only has 200-300 hit points
at the most.
You must now choose between Maia and Lena. Wed Maia and you shall
become king of Cille. Marry Lena and you shall be king of Landen and
neighboring Satera.
